安装ngiinx
时间 : 2024-01-10 10:12: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

安装Nginx是一项重要的任务,因为Nginx是一个性能强大、稳定可靠的Web服务器软件。本文将为你提供安装Nginx的详细步骤。

1. 更新系统:首先,确保系统是最新的状态。在终端中使用以下命令来更新系统:

sudo apt update

sudo apt upgrade

2. 安装Nginx:接下来,使用以下命令来安装Nginx:

sudo apt install nginx

3. 启动Nginx:安装完成后,可以使用以下命令来启动Nginx服务:

sudo systemctl start nginx

4. 验证Nginx是否安装成功:在Web浏览器中输入你的服务器IP地址,如果看到Nginx的默认欢迎页面,说明安装成功。默认情况下,Nginx的网站文件存储在`/var/www/html`目录下。

5. 配置防火墙:如果你的服务器上启用了防火墙,那么需要允许HTTP和HTTPS流量通过。使用以下命令开启HTTP和HTTPS端口:

sudo ufw allow 'Nginx HTTP'

sudo ufw allow 'Nginx HTTPS'

6. 设置Nginx开机自启动:为了确保Nginx在系统重启后可以自动启动,可以使用以下命令来设置:

sudo systemctl enable nginx

7. 基本的Nginx配置:Nginx的主要配置文件位于`/etc/nginx/nginx.conf`。根据自己的需求进行修改和定制,然后重新加载Nginx配置文件,使用以下命令:

sudo systemctl reload nginx

现在,你已经成功安装并配置了Nginx。你可以通过访问服务器的IP地址或域名来查看Nginx的默认欢迎页面。接下来,你可以进一步学习Nginx的高级功能和配置,以满足自己的需求。祝你使用愉快!

其他答案

安装Nginx服务器是一个相对简单的过程,下面是一个简单的指南来帮助您完成安装过程。

步骤1:更新系统软件包

首先,我们需要确保系统上的软件包是最新的。打开终端并运行以下命令:

sudo apt update

sudo apt upgrade

这将更新所有软件包,并确保系统准备好安装新的软件。

步骤2:安装Nginx

使用以下命令在Ubuntu系统上安装Nginx:

sudo apt install nginx

确认安装时,您将被提示输入密码。输入您的密码并按下Enter键,然后按y键以继续安装。

安装完成后,您可以通过运行以下命令来验证Nginx是否已成功安装:

nginx -v

如果Nginx已成功安装,将显示安装的版本信息。

步骤3:配置防火墙

默认情况下,Ubuntu服务器上的防火墙是启用的。为了允许Nginx通过防火墙,您需要更新防火墙规则并允许HTTP和HTTPS流量。以下是一些基本的命令来更新防火墙规则:

sudo ufw allow 'Nginx HTTP'

sudo ufw allow 'Nginx HTTPS'

sudo ufw enable

运行以上命令后,您将确认防火墙已配置为允许Nginx服务器通过HTTP和HTTPS流量。

步骤4:启动Nginx

一旦Nginx成功安装并配置,您可以使用以下命令启动Nginx服务器:

sudo systemctl start nginx

您还可以使用以下命令检查Nginx服务器的状态:

sudo systemctl status nginx

如果一切正常,您将看到Nginx正在运行。

步骤5:测试Nginx

为了确保Nginx服务器正常工作,您可以在浏览器中输入服务器的IP地址或域名,并查看是否显示Nginx欢迎页面。如果显示成功,那么恭喜您已经成功安装并配置了Nginx服务器。

总结

安装Nginx服务器只需几个简单的步骤。在更新软件包,安装Nginx,配置防火墙和启动Nginx后,您可以通过浏览器测试Nginx服务器是否正常运行。